2021 Southeast Uncommitted Showcase (2022 Grads)
Will Brown is a 2022 1B/2B with a 5-11 165 lb. frame from Macon, GA who attends Covenant Academy. Recorded 7.50 seconds in the sixty-yard dash. Primary first baseman fields the ball with a bend at the waist, clean glove actions, and funnels the ball out front from a three-quarter arm slot while accurately throwing the ball across the diamond. Right-handed hitter steps to the plate preloading the back leg with a wide stance and is slightly closed off with the front foot alongside high hands and a high back elbow. Brown has a simple leg lift stride and throws the barrel at the ball working with a middle of the field approach while developing backspin on the ball. Tremendous student.

Swing Efficiency™
Swing Efficiency™ is a score from 0-100 based on how fast you move your body compared to other players of a similar height and weight. Our library of over 10,000 hitters shows that for a given body type, higher swing efficiencies generate higher exit velos. PG All-American Arjun Nimmala may only weigh 170 lbs, but he can still hit 103MPH off a tee thanks to his elite Swing Efficiency™.
